Description

There are two kinds of eagles living in North America: bald eagles and golden eagles. This volume explores the lives of both. It covers: how many feathers an eagles has; the colour of a golden eagle's beak; where bald eagles build their aeries; when eaglets hatch; and more. Many mysteries of eagles are explained in the text and Fun Facts. There are accompanying illustrations and close-up photographs, as well as a list of related Internet sites.
